    New Chinese CO2 laser - laser head shuddering

    Hello all

    We have a new laser at our community mens shed, has done 2 hours work, now the laser head x axis shudders violently on start up and when running a file, jog function not working either but Y axis looks fine.

    Re: New Chinese CO2 laser - laser head shuddering

    Look for loose connections on the cables. If they all feel good you could power down the machine and switch the motors or motor driver between the x and y axis and see if the problem moves to the other is. If it does then it is a motor or driver or bad cable
